After all 48 dogs were evaluated; the USDA gave permission to the rescuers to transfer the remaining 16 dogs who were not yet adopted. Three of those dogs were taken by rescue groups to the east coast and the other thirteen were loaded up in a rented RV and headed west with the Bad Rap team. This was by no means an easy mission. They also had to be very careful of their route and which towns they drove through, because many towns have breed specific legislation in place against pit bulls. After a long trek across country, with many stops lasting hours to insure all dogs got walked and relived themselves, the team finally made it to the San Francisco Bay Area.

The breed specific legislation (BSL) that made it dangerous to travel with these dogs exists not only in communities with breed bans, but also in homes and apartment complexes across the country. Countless Pit Bulls die without a chance to be adopted because of landlords who do not allow tenants to have them. If this discrimination could be alleviated, many, many more would be saved. USAA and Farmers are both Pit Bull friendly companies that offer homeowners insurance!
